Contract Terms
| Term | Glide | OutSystems |
|---|---|---|
| Auto-renewal | Yes | Yes |
| Cancellation | Cancellation may not prevent immediate next billing cycle | — |
| Minimum commitment | — | 1 year |
| Price escalation | Users report retroactive pricing changes and plan restructuring that significantly increased costs without clear warning | Pricing model changes have pushed existing customers out. Users report that OutSystems can change pricing structure mid-contract, forcing renegotiation or migration. |
| Can downgrade | — | No |
